Looking After Your Baseball Caps
Maintaining caps in excellent shape requires consistent attention and attention. Adequate care is essential; most caps can be spot cleaned with explore now a moist fabric and gentle soap. For more thorough cleaning, hand-washing in cool water is recommended, avoiding harsh chemicals that may dull hues or harm fabrics.
Storage is essential for preserving their shape. Caps need to be stored upright in a cool and dry area, ideally on a shelf or in a dedicated cap box to avoid crushing.
Additionally, alternating the use of caps aids in preventing significant wear. Avoid exposing them to intense sunlight for extended periods, as this can lead to fading.
Finally, for those with flexible straps, make sure they are not overly tightened to protect the cap's condition. Through these care practices, caps can continue to be fashionable and practical accessories for years to come.

What Materials Excel Best for Assorted Types of Caps?
Cotton and twill function nicely for casual caps, delivering breathability and comfort. In colder weather, wool offers warmth, while polyester blends boost durability and moisture-wicking. Each material meets particular demands and looks effectively.

What Method Works Clean Set-in Spots From My Cap?
To remove stubborn stains from a cap, gently clean the area with a blend of gentle cleanser and water using a fine-bristled brush. Rinse thoroughly and air dry to preserve the cap's shape and fabric integrity.
